Welcome, we are so glad you found us. This is our 8th Give to the Max Day! We achieved non-profit status on 9/24/2018, and have already saved almost 700 bully type dogs and have adopted 650 of those dogs thus far. Give to the Max Day 2025 will allow us to *hopefully* help financially to start taking on even more of the harder medical and behavioral cases. In 2025 we started taking on a lot more medical and behavioral cases from our local shelters like Neville, Kylie, Cassidy, Shandy, Gator, Bob Barker, Cinder, Benetar, Craig, Major, BamBam, Cinta, Dante, and Jame.. just to name a few.  Our total medical and training bills so far for 2025 have totaled more than $175,000. We provide high-quality medical care to every single dog that comes through UBPBR, along with monthly heart worm and flea/tick prevention, quality dog-food, enrichment, training, and so much more. UnbreakaBULL is a new, progressive, passionate group of volunteer rescuers who strive to show the public the inherent good within bully-breed dogs. Our executive director, Sara, has been deeply involved in local rescue for over 15-years. She holds invaluable experience in pit bull rehabilitation, and when coupled with her unwavering fervor to “save them all”, this has made her an irreplaceable force within the MN rescue community. 

Our mission is simple: we collaborate as a team and work tirelessly to reduce the amount of pit bull-type dogs facing unnecessary euthanasia in local Minnesota shelters. Pit Bulls are resilient, inherently good, and unconditionally loving - essentially, they are UnbreakaBULL.
